Output 91d725e0829216da9cb310eee60e335beee2092d801476dc2fd4252b75b1b1ba:6

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c853b8f6ed51ed684a5b1e79c66b45c6a79f29e9 OP_EQUAL
address
3KxFN3zP1dGj7PfHsdUbRw754Hj3KLVSKA
transaction
91d725e0829216da9cb310eee60e335beee2092d801476dc2fd4252b75b1b1ba
confirmations
142866
spent
true